Output 57caf30c768b9232482f6098a6196f15afe89c50f672bb5a9eadffab2def6e8e:1

value
95100
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5a634ca11f6e7a98d167ef76023579e138212170249f592d3a26a7bb8e353773
address
bc1ptf35eggldeaf35t8aamqydteuyuzzgtsyj04jtf6y6nmhr34xaesj58tpx
transaction
57caf30c768b9232482f6098a6196f15afe89c50f672bb5a9eadffab2def6e8e
spent
true